32 Dead in Bihar Storm: Nitish Promises Personal Attention

A total of 32 people were killed while 80 were injured on Tuesday night in Bihar after a storm hit three districts.

A total of 32 people were killed and more than 80 injured after a heavy storm hit Purnea, Madhepura and Madhubani districts of Bihar on Tuesday night.

As many as 10,000 houses were ravaged by the storm while mobile services were also hit. Fallen trees have also hampered road connectivity and power supply in the region.

On Wednesday, the Nitish Kumar-led state government announced a compensation of Rs four lakh each for the families of the victims.

We are assessing the situation, and appropriate measures will be taken. The incident took place in the night.
– Chief Minister Nitish Kumar

Purnea district was the worst hit with 25 people losing their lives there. Six people died in Madhepura and one in Madhubani district. 

Bihar Chief Minister Nitish Kumar is slated to do an aerial survey of the affected areas on Wednesday. He said that he will personally take stock of the situation and ensure every possible help. He will also meet the families of the victims.

The locals have been helping the administration in removing the trees blocking access to the villages.
